How much do frontier communications jobs pay per year?

As of Jun 7, 2026, the average yearly pay for frontier communications in the United States is $85,857.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$66,000.00 and $97,500.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What opportunities for career advancement are available at Frontier Communications?

Frontier Communications offers a variety of career advancement paths, especially for those motivated to grow within the company. Employees can move into supervisory or management positions, transition between departments such as customer service, technical support, or network operations, and participate in internal training programs to enhance their skills. The company values internal promotions and often provides mentorship and development resources to help team members reach their career goals. Collaboration across departments is common, allowing employees to expand their professional network and learn about different aspects of the telecommunications industry.

What does a Frontier Communications employee do?

A Frontier Communications employee typically works in telecommunications, providing services such as internet, phone, and television to residential and business customers. Job roles vary widely across the company and can include customer service, technical support, installation and maintenance, sales, and network engineering. Employees help ensure reliable connectivity, assist customers with troubleshooting, and support the company’s infrastructure. The specific duties depend on the position, but all roles contribute to delivering and maintaining high-quality communication services.
